Reagan hit Clark with a four-run fifth inning on Friday, which goes a long way in explaining the final result. The Cougars fell just short of the Rattlers by a score of 6-5. The Cougars have struggled against the Rattlers recently, as the game was their ninth consecutive lost matchup.
Nate McDonald was cooking despite his team's loss, going 2-for-3 with two triples, two RBI, and one run. Peter Flores-King was another key player, going 1-for-2 with one run and one RBI.
Clark's defeat dropped their record down to 10-15. As for Reagan, the victory made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 17-9.
The teams didn't have to wait long for a rematch: the Rattlers beat Clark by a score of 3-1 on Saturday.
